#include "config.h"
#include <errno.h>
#ifdef __STDC__
# include <stdarg.h>
#else
# include <varargs.h>
#endif
#ifndef lint
static const char rcsid[] = "$Sudo: sudo_noexec.c,v 1.11 2005/03/10 15:09:28 millert Exp $";
#endif /* lint */
/*
* Dummy versions of the execve() family of syscalls. We don't need
* to stub out all of them, just the ones that correspond to actual
* system calls (which varies by OS). Note that it is still possible
* to access the real syscalls via the syscall() interface but very
* few programs actually do that.
*/
#ifndef errno
extern int errno;
#endif
#define DUMMY_BODY \
{ \
errno = EACCES; \
return(-1); \
}
#ifdef __STDC__
#define DUMMY2(fn, t1, t2) \
int \
fn(t1 a1, t2 a2) \
DUMMY_BODY
#define DUMMY3(fn, t1, t2, t3) \
int \
fn(t1 a1, t2 a2, t3 a3) \
DUMMY_BODY
#define DUMMY_VA(fn, t1, t2) \
int \
fn(t1 a1, t2 a2, ...) \
DUMMY_BODY
#else /* !__STDC__ */
#define DUMMY2(fn, t1, t2) \
int \
fn(a1, a2) \
t1 a1; t2 a2; \
DUMMY_BODY
#define DUMMY3(fn, t1, t2, t3) \
int \
fn(a1, a2, a3) \
t1 a1; t2 a2; t3 a3; \
DUMMY_BODY
#define DUMMY_VA(fn, t1, t2) \
int \
fn(a1, a2, va_alist) \
t1 a1; t2 a2; va_dcl \
DUMMY_BODY
#endif /* !__STDC__ */
DUMMY_VA(execl, const char *, const char *)
DUMMY_VA(_execl, const char *, const char *)
DUMMY_VA(__execl, const char *, const char *)
DUMMY_VA(execle, const char *, const char *)
DUMMY_VA(_execle, const char *, const char *)
DUMMY_VA(__execle, const char *, const char *)
DUMMY_VA(execlp, const char *, const char *)
DUMMY_VA(_execlp, const char *, const char *)
DUMMY_VA(__execlp, const char *, const char *)
DUMMY2(execv, const char *, char * const *)
DUMMY2(_execv, const char *, char * const *)
DUMMY2(__execv, const char *, char * const *)
DUMMY2(execvp, const char *, char * const *)
DUMMY2(_execvp, const char *, char * const *)
DUMMY2(__execvp, const char *, char * const *)
DUMMY3(execvP, const char *, const char *, char * const *)
DUMMY3(_execvP, const char *, const char *, char * const *)
DUMMY3(__execvP, const char *, const char *, char * const *)
DUMMY3(execve, const char *, char * const *, char * const *)
DUMMY3(_execve, const char *, char * const *, char * const *)
DUMMY3(__execve, const char *, char * const *, char * const *)
DUMMY3(fexecve, int , char * const *, char * const *)
DUMMY3(_fexecve, int , char * const *, char * const *)
DUMMY3(__fexecve, int , char * const *, char * const *)
